Washing Suede Vans . Before deep-cleaning suede Vans shoes, it is recommended to use a soft suede brush to remove surface dirt from the tops, sides, and bottoms of your shoes. To deep-clean suede Vans shoes, use a small amount of specialist suede cleaner on a toothbrush and work it into the stained areas of suede. To clean white vans with detergent, combine two cups warm water and a 1/4 cup laundry detergent. Apply the liquid solution to the shoe surfaces, then scrub the surfaces with a brush dipped in the solution. To clean the rubber soles, use a toothbrush that has been used for a long time.

The gentlest way to clean white Vans is to fill a bowl, bucket, or sink with warm water and add a few drops of gentle liquid dish soap. Swish the water to create suds. Use an old toothbrush or soft scrubbing brush dipped in the water and gently brush your Vans in a circular motion. Rinse the shoes using a moist cloth.How to clean checkered Vans with baking soda: Mix baking soda and water to create a paste. Apply the paste onto the checkered areas of the shoes. Gently scrub the shoes with a soft-bristled brush or sponge. Rinse the shoes with clean water to remove any baking soda residue. Spot-treat tough stains by applying a stain remover on them beforehand. Apply right to the spots, then wait 15 minutes. Hand wash your Vans with warm water and a little bit of mild detergent after removing the insoles and laces. After swaddling your wet Vans in a towel and squeezing out any extra water, let them air dry.

You can use a paste of baking soda and mild detergent to whiten the inside of your Vans.
